Kate Maloney joined Advocacy Trust in 2021 as Regional Trust Director for our Mooresville, NC office. Kate brings over 30 years of trust industry experience, focusing on trust administration, client relationships, and management. Kate began her career in the trust industry as a Trust Operations Officer at the First National Bank of Rhinebeck. During the next ten years, she progressed to a Trust Officer/VP and graduated with honors from the Cannon Trust School, the Cannon Trust Audit and Compliance School, and obtained her CTFA designation.

In 2000, Kate joined Fiduciary Trust Company International as a Trust Administration Officer and worked on numerous high-net-worth family relationships. During this time, she completed the ABA Trust Graduate programs. In 2006, Kate joined the Bank of Millbrook to lead the Trust Department and successfully built the department and grew the client assets for the Bank. She joined Hudson Valley Bank Trust Services Division in 2011, where she focused on the administration of special needs trusts, guardianships, and court-appointed trusts. In 2013, Kate was promoted to the SVP and Trust Services Director, managing a team of trust professionals focused on the special needs trust area of the business in the New York City metro market. In 2014, she joined Orange Bank & Trust Company as SVP and Trust Services Director, where she led the effort to expand the division, including expanding the market footprint for the division by adding a new team and building the special needs trust business for the bank. 

Kate brings a passion for delivering excellence in service, knowledge, and client relationships to Advocacy Trust. Kate has been a guest lecturer for the NYS Bar Association Elder Law Section, NYS Bankers Association Trust and Investment Division, and the Estate Planning Councils of Westchester and Putnam Counties. She was active in the New York State Bankers Association as the past Chair of the Trust and Investment Division, Board Member, Executive Committee, Legislative Committee, and Trust Administration Committee. She also believes in community service and, most recently, was the Treasurer of the Orange County Arts Council and a Board Member of the Garnet Health Medical Center Foundation.
